Latest Patents

Tatyana's latest patents include "Compositions of adult disc stem cells and methods for the treatment of degenerative disc disease." This invention provides an isolated disc stem cell population, compositions, and methods of obtaining and growing the same. Additionally, it introduces an isolated discosphere, along with methods for obtaining and cultivating these cells. An artificial disc containing the cells from this invention is also provided, along with methods for its creation. Furthermore, the invention outlines a method for treating subjects with herniated discs using the cells and techniques developed.
